Canada - Communications, computer, etc. (% of service exports, BoP)

Communications, computer, etc. (% of service exports, BoP) in Canada was 63.32 as of 2021. Its highest value over the past 61 years was 63.32 in 2021, while its lowest value was 20.04 in 1967.

Definition: Communications, computer, information, and other services cover international telecommunications; computer data; news-related service transactions between residents and nonresidents; construction services; royalties and license fees; miscellaneous business, professional, and technical services; personal, cultural, and recreational services; manufacturing services on physical inputs owned by others; and maintenance and repair services and government services not included elsewhere.

Source: International Monetary Fund, Balance of Payments Statistics Yearbook and data files.
